Community
Lantern Project: Ghost Salmon Run
Join
community artist Paula Jardine in the creation of glowing salmon and
roe lanterns for the "Ghost Salmon Run" installation at
Luminara this year. Participants are invited to include their lanterns
in Luminara where the glowing stream of fish will be accompanied by
the hauntingly beautiful harmonies of the RiverSong Singers, led by
singer/composer Carolyn Knight. And, of course, take their lanterns
home to illuminate their own gardens afterwards.
Paula
will teach workshop participants how to make a three foot long salmon
lantern out of wire and tissue paper, with the option of making little
roe lanterns for younger participants.
